Where the Lillies Bloom in Ruins

Are received a grant to produce new music. With Where the Lillies Bloom in Ruins, Ara releases their debut EP, blending timeless folk with the acoustic pop of today. The project balances dark and idyllic tones, both musically and thematically. Ara’s music has been described as nostalgic and comforting—like gathering around a fire in a moment of connection. With stories of home at its heart, Ara takes you to ancient worlds, to a place tucked between mountains, to its meadows, ruins, and all its forgotten tales.

Ara is a singer-songwriter from Tilburg with Armenian roots, effortlessly weaving timeless folk with contemporary acoustic pop. With music that is both accessible and distinctive, Ara creates dreamy fingerstyle guitar ballads and soaring hymns infused with Armenian influences. In a short time, Ara has gone from street performer to playing major venues. Following the dreamy debut single Meadows and the poetic, mournful anthem Ruins—a song rich with cultural resonance—Ara joined Dutch band Racoon on tour across the Netherlands.
